Susquehanna Hose Company Division 5
Susquehanna Hose Company Division 5 is a fire station in Harford County, Maryland. Susquehanna Hose Company Division 5 is situated nearby to the hamlet Perry Point.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Havre de Grace Racetrack
Geographical marker
The Havre de Grace Racetrack was an American horse racing track on Post Road in Havre de Grace, Harford County, Maryland. Nicknamed "The Graw," it operated from August 24, 1912, to 1950. Havre de Grace Racetrack is situated 1¼ miles south of Susquehanna Hose Company Division 5.

Havre de Grace
Photo: Ted Kerwin, CC BY 2.0.
Havre de Grace is a small city of approximately 15,000 residents in northeastern Maryland. Named by General Lafayette, it was attacked by the Royal Navy during the War of 1812.
Perryville
Photo: Pubdog, Public domain.
Perryville is a town in Cecil County, Maryland, United States. The population was 4,361 at the 2010 census. The town is located near an exit for Interstate 95, on the north side of the outlet of the Susquehanna River.
